[0026] figure 1 A connector system 100 is shown with a hydraulic connector 105 and a control device 110 . The connector 105 comprises an input side 115 and an output side 120 , which are rotatably mounted about a common axis of rotation 125 . Hydraulic fluid 130 represents the torque coupling between input side 115 and output side 120 . The input side 115 is supported relative to the output side 120 by means of at least one rolling bearing 135 . Depending on the type of coupling, in particular describing the coupling for the introduction and delivery of torque, the loads acting on the rolling bearings 135 can be different, even if their arrangement does not change. One or more seals 140 , which may contain different materials, may be arranged between the input side 115 and the output side 120 .
